If you have several projects in your house, divide them up into several smaller DIY projects. For example you may want to redo the entire living room. Start simple, by just replacing the carpet, and before you know it, your living room will be like new.

If you have no counter space, install a microwave over the range. You can find these type of microwave ovens in a variety of prices. Many of them have special features like convection cooking. Many of these units feature a filter rather than outdoor venting, so they are better suited to situations that don't require extreme ventilation.

If you are taking on your project alone, consider hiring a interior designer for a consultation. An hour with a professional can help clarify what you want to do and help steer you away from those projects that sound good in your head but would be a nightmare to complete.
